Why Space Sustainability Matters
As humanity reaches further into the cosmos, the need for sustainable practices becomes increasingly critical. Space sustainability refers to the responsible use of outer space to ensure that future generations can continue to explore and utilize space resources. This involves minimizing space debris, protecting the space environment, and ensuring that space activities do not harm the Earth's biosphere or other celestial bodies.
Planetary Protection: A Core Component
Planetary protection is a fundamental aspect of space sustainability. It involves safeguarding planets, moons, and other celestial bodies from contamination by Earth-originating life forms and vice versa. This is crucial not only for preserving the natural state of these bodies but also for ensuring the integrity of scientific research conducted in space. The BS EN 16604-20:2020 standard provides guidelines and protocols to prevent biological contamination, ensuring that space missions do not inadvertently introduce terrestrial microbes to other planets or bring extraterrestrial organisms back to Earth.

BS EN 16604-20:2020
This standard BS EN 16604-20:2020 Space sustainability. Planetary protection is classified in these ICS categories:
- 49.140 Space systems and operations
This standard contains planetary protection requirements, including:
Planetary protection management requirements;
Technical planetary protection requirements for robotic and human missions (forward and backward contamination);
Planetary protection requirements related to procedures;
Document Requirements Descriptions (DRD) and their relation to the respective reviews.
This standard may be tailored for the specific characteristic and constraints of a space project in conformance with ECSS-S-ST-00.
